Luc Bourdon, a first round pick (10th overall) for the Vancouver Canucks from the 2005 NHL Entry draft was killed this morning in a motorcycle accident. Although not a star player, he was still an important asset to the team as an excellent skater and a powerful offensive player.

He was instrunmental in Canada's gold-medal win at the 07 world juniors with four points in six games, as well as six points in as many games at the 06 tourny in Vancouver, in which Canada took the win over Russia. Although he never got the chance to prove himself as a true Canuck, he had very high expectations placed on his shoulders and he will truly be missed.
